Typical symptoms include nasal itching, continuous paroxysmal sneezing, copious watery nasal discharge and nasal congestion. The specific performance is as follows: [Itchy nose and continuous sneezing] There are often several paroxysmal continuous sneezing attacks every day, followed by nasal congestion and runny nose, especially in the morning and at night. Nasal itching is seen in most patients, and sometimes there is also itching outside the nose, soft palate, face and external auditory canal. Eye itching is more obvious in seasonal rhinitis. [A lot of clear nasal mucus] When you sneeze, a lot of mucus will flow out. However, when the acute reaction tends to weaken or disappear, the discharge may decrease or become thicker; if secondary infection occurs, it may become a mucopurulent discharge. [Nasal congestion] The degree of severity varies, and it may be unilateral or bilateral, intermittent or continuous, or alternating. [Olfaction disorder] If it is caused by mucosal edema or nasal congestion, it is usually temporary. Those caused by persistent mucosal edema leading to olfactory nerve atrophy are mostly persistent.
